Is this considered a seasonal fragrance?+−
While it can be worn year-round, the community favors it most for spring. Its fresh bergamot and airy rice powder notes also make it a popular choice for summer, though it retains enough creamy sandalwood to transition comfortably into fall.
How does the performance compare to other L'Artisan Parfumeur scents?+−
Many fans of the house find that Le Chant de Camargue has better longevity than the brand's lighter floral or citrus waters. It is often compared to a standard eau de parfum performance—noticeable for several hours without being overpowering.
Is this a sweet, "food-like" gourmand?+−
No, it is classified as a woody creamy fragrance. While the rice note is central, it is savory and starchy rather than sugary. The sweetness is natural and subtle, derived from the sandalwood rather than vanilla or syrup.
What setting is this fragrance best suited for?+−
Due to its clean and powdery profile, it is highly recommended for daily wear, business settings, and leisure. It is considered an "easy reach" for situations where you want to smell put-together and calm without making a loud statement.
